Publisher Description
Former US Secretary of State Madeline Albright on this edition of Fresh Air. Before being appointed by President Clinton in 1996, she served as the US Permanent Representative to the United Nations. She also served in Clinton's cabinet and on the National Security Council. Albright's new memoir is entitled Madam Secretary. (Broadcast Date: September 16, 2003)
